There is a condition called atrophic vaginitus, which usually affects women who have a decrease in estrogen levels due to menopause or following giving birth!. However women who smoke, who are not sexually active or haven't given birth are also more likely to suffer from it!.

The symptoms include burning, itching, pressure or discharge!. Intercourse is painful and may be followed by light bleeding!. Urinary tract symptoms can also occur including frequency and painful urination!.

It would take a doctor to diagnose you, and requires an examination, so I can't tell you that is definitely what you have!. But it's one possibility, and I mention it to ease your mind a bit!. I can tell by the wording of your question how stressed you are, and just want to assure you that this could well be something simple and not something dire as you may be imagining!.

If it is this condition, the treatment for it is aimed at reducing the discomfort of dryness during everyday activities and restoring lubrication during intercourse!.
